## Payroll Export Change — Quick Brief

As of this cycle, Tallgrain's payroll exports moved from fixed-width to the v3 delimited format. Downstream jobs in the Mulberry pipeline expect the new header row; anything still parsing column offsets will break. Do not re-enable the legacy exporter. Test against the staging drop, not production files. Field definitions, rounding rules, and the cutover checklist are maintained on the internal reference page here.

runbook for badug-kadup: https://confluence.zemvarlabs.internal/projects/browse/display/projects/bd1b

### Changelog — FieldNote Surveyor 2.8.0

Big one this release: offline mode finally landed. Surveyors can now cache map tiles and queue submissions without a connection, and everything syncs when they're back in range. We also rotated the build signing key as part of the quarterly schedule — the old key is revoked as of this release, so any 2.7.x artifacts re-signed after today will fail verification. Make sure the distribution portal is updated before you push. The new signing key for 2.8.0 builds follows.

deploy key for bajeg-yagug: bky4_Uyq7

**Q: What are the holiday opening hours?**

Holidays at Drayhall Tower: building closed 24 Dec through 2 Jan. Night shift retains access via the rear service entrance only. Main doors locked, reception unstaffed, no deliveries accepted. Heating runs on reduced schedule; report faults to the duty line. Cleaners off-site for the full period, so flatten your own boxes. The rear entrance reader is offline during the shutdown, so you'll need the keypad code below.

staff pass of kawip-hawef = bdg-QLP-2

Notes, records meeting 12th: agreed the 2014–2019 paper ledgers move to the Dunmarsh archive facility next week. Boxes are indexed and sealed; the manifest stays with the shipment. Records team to double-check box counts against the index before release. Nothing leaves without the transfer form signed. The hand-over instruction for the courier is set out directly below.

handover note for kajop-yawep: the ulair jorox courier leaves the belax ledger at gate 9133 under passcode 401596